Abstract: This study examines the effects of Lao Cai sourced graphite on the mechanical and electrical properties of high strength fine grained concrete (HSFGC). Graphite was incorporated at 0%, 1%, 5%, and 10% by cement weight. Results showed a significant reduction in compressive and flexural strengths with increasing graphite content, while electrical conductivity improved markedly due to the formation of an internal conductive network. The mechanical degradation is attributed to graphite's soft texture, poor bonding, and chemical inertness. These findings demonstrate the potential of utilizing indigenous graphite to develop multifunctional, smart concrete materials for advanced infrastructure and smart city applications in Vietnam.
